Biography
William Dear (born November 30, 1944) is a Canadian-born American film and television director, producer and writer. He holds a degree in Art and Theater from Central Michigan University, Mount Pleasant, USA. He is known for directing the films Angels in the Outfield and Harry and the Hendersons.
